Citalopram does not interfere with the metabolism of APDs. At a dose of 40 mg/day, citalopram caused no significant changes in plasma concentrations of chlorpromazine, clozapine, haloperidol, perphenazine, thioridazine, or zuclopenthixol. Anecdotal data suggest that citalopram may increase the serum levels of levomepromazine. [Pg.165]

Citalopram. A study in schizophrenic patients found that over a 12-week period the serum levels of perphenazine were not significantly altered by citalopram 40 mg daily. ... [Pg.713]

On the whole significant interactions between the antipsychotics and SSRIs appear rare (although see thioridazine, below). The combination can be useful and so the isolated cases of extrapyramidal adverse effects should not prevent concurrent use. However, if extrapyramidal effects become troublesome bear this interaction in mind as a possible cause. The significance of the rise in haloperidol levels caused by fluoxetine and fluvoxamine is unclear, be aware that haloperidol adverse effects may be increased in some patients and consider reducing the haloperidol dose if problems occur. The rise in perphenazine levels caused by paroxetine seems to result in a greater number of more serious adverse effects and so consideration should be given to reducing the dose of perphenazine if paroxetine is started. Citalopram may be a suitable alternative as it does not appear to affect perphenazine levels. [Pg.713]
